The Solution

More children die from conditions that could have been treated by surgery than from malaria, HIV and TB combined. This is what No Room to Operate means for children across the globe. Pain. Suffering. Disability. Death.

So what's the solution?

We believe that every child deserves access to safe surgery. Instead of a lifetime of pain, surgery gives children another chance. A chance to return to their education, lead lives free from suffering, a chance to play, to learn. A chance to live.

Kids Operating Room is the only charity dedicated solely to solving this glaring gap in global health. We're providing local teams with world- class surgical services, facilities and training, so children can access the care they need.

Before After

Since 2018, Kids Operating have helped to provide 100,000 children with life-changing surgery.

This is more than 1,500,000 years of disability for children prevented. Not only does this allow a child the chance to thrive, it frees families from a life-time of caring.

The impact this has on a country is astonishing - our work has created more than $3,000,000,000 in economic benefit for the countries we work in.
